site stats

Deadlock in operating system ppt

WebIntroduction to Operating System and Operating System Components - A deadlock state is a state of indefinite wait by one or more processes for an event that can be triggered … WebThe deadlock-avoidance algorithm dynamically examines the resource-allocation state to ensure that there can never be a circular-wait condition. Resource-allocation state is defined by the number of available and allocated resources, and the …

CPSC 457: Slides - University of Calgary in Alberta

WebOperating System Concepts – 10th Edition 8.13 Silberschatz, Galvin and Gagne ©2024, revised by S. Weiss 2024 Resource Allocation Graph Facts If graph contains no cycles no deadlock If graph contains a cycle If each resource type has just a single instance of the resource, then a cycle implies deadlock If there is at least one resource type that has … WebMar 30, 2024 · Deadlocks: examples of deadlock, resource concepts, necessary conditions for deadlock, deadlock solution, deadlock prevention, deadlock avoidance with Bankers algorithms, deadlock detection, deadlock recovery. Device Management: Disk Scheduling Strategies, Rotational Optimization, System Consideration, Caching and Buffering. UNIT IV maurice watkins obituary https://orchestre-ou-balcon.com

COS 318: Operating Systems Deadlocks - Princeton …

WebIt is application developers’ job to deal with their deadlocks OS provides mechanisms to break applications’ deadlocks Kernel should not have any deadlocks Use prevention … WebDeadlocks - PPT (Powerpoint Presentation), Operating Systems, Semester - Computer Science Engineering (CSE) Download, print and study this document offline. Download … WebView Deadlock Operating System PPTs online, safely and virus-free! Many are downloadable. Learn new and interesting things. Get ideas for your own presentations. Share yours for free! ... Deadlock with powerpoint notes Because deadlock is a difficult concept that often looks easy. I have provided yet MORE notes on deadlock extracted … maurice watson jr offers

What is Deadlock Characterization? - Binary Terms

Category:Chapter 7: Deadlocks - IIT Kharagpur

Tags:Deadlock in operating system ppt

Deadlock in operating system ppt

Operating System: Deadlock - SlideShare

Web15 Prevention: No Preemption Make the scheduler be aware of resource allocation Method If the system cannot satisfy a request from a process holding resources, preempt the process and release all resources Schedule it only if the system satisfies all resources Alternative Preempt the process holding the requested resource WebDeadlock Detection Allow system to enter deadlock state Detection algorithm Recovery scheme 7.31 32 Single Instance of Each Resource Type Maintain wait-for graph Nodes are processes pj if e. is waiting for …

Deadlock in operating system ppt

Did you know?

WebSafe State Checking Algorithm 1. Look for a row, R, whose unmet resource needs are all smaller than or equal to A. If no such row exists, the system will eventually deadlock since no process can run to completion. 2. Assume the process of the row chosen requests all the resources it needs (which is guaranteed to be possible) and finishes. Mark that process … Web(2) Here are the PPT slides for deadlock avoidance and prevention techniques. (1) Here are the PPT slides for the concept of "process deadlock". February 15: (3) Here are the execises on February 14th (PART II) (MS word format). (2) Here are the execises on February 14th (PART I) (MS word format).

WebAll solutions below based on idea of locking Protecting critical regions via locks Uniprocessors – could disable interrupts Currently running code would execute without preemption Generally too inefficient on multiprocessor systems Operating systems using this not broadly scalable Modern machines provide special atomic hardware instructions ... WebJun 25, 2013 · Deadlocks in operating system 1 of 17 Deadlocks in operating system Jun. 25, 2013 • 42 likes • 29,023 views Download …

Web操作系统第七版第六章第二部分PPT_理学_高等教育_...? Can also leads to a deadlock; Operating ...2005 End of Chapter 6 文档贡献者 yfwl12345 ... 操作系统课件第八章. 操作系统课件第八章 隐藏>> Chapter 7: Deadlocks...System Concepts 7.6 Silberschatz, Galvin and ...possibility of deadlock. ? Avoidance ... WebThe video explains how the concept of deadlock in operating system with an example. Also, the necessary conditions for the deadlock in operating system to occur are explained. For PPT on...

WebAug 2, 2014 · • Definition of deadlock • Example of deadlock • Resource allocation graph • Strategies to handle deadlock - Deadlock Prevention - Deadlock Avoidance - …

WebThere are three methods: Ignore Deadlocks: Ensure deadlock neveroccurs using either PreventionPrevent any one of the 4 conditions from happening. AvoidanceAllow all deadlock conditions, but calculate cycles about to happen and stop dangerous operations.. Allowdeadlock to happen. This requires using both: DetectionKnow a deadlock has … maurice watson kansas cityWebDeadlock Management Prevention Design the system in such a way that deadlocks can never occur Avoidance Impose less stringent conditions than for prevention, allowing the possibility of deadlock but sidestepping it as it occurs. Detection Allow possibility of deadlock, determine if deadlock has occurred and which processes and resources are … maurice watson ministryWebThere are three types of memory in every system: 1. Volatile: Fast, expensive and small cache memory, made up of the same material as the CPU. 2. Volatile: Medium-speed and medium-size Random Access Memory 9 Operating systems must accomplish the following tasks: Processor management. maurice watkins realtorWebContent of this lecture 6.1 Resources 6.2 Deadlock 6.3 Ostrich Algorithm 6.4 Deadlock Detection & Deadlock Recovery 6.5 Deadlock Avoidance 6.6 Deadlock Prevention 6.7 Other Issues Summary 上一页 第2页 下一页 maurice way marlboroughWebOperating System Concepts – 8th Edition 7.17 Silberschatz, Galvin and Gagne ©2009 Deadlock Avoidance Simplest and most useful model requires that each process … maurice watson accidentWebJun 17, 2013 · Deadlock • A set of processes is in a deadlock state when every process in the set is waiting for an event (e.g. release of a resource) that can only be caused by … maurice w brown oil \\u0026 gas llcWebTài liệu về Bài giảng hệ điều hành chương 5 deadlock - Tài liệu , Bai giang he dieu hanh chuong 5 deadlock - Tai lieu tại 123doc - Thư viện trực tuyến hàng đầu Việt Nam ... Deadlocks ppt ... CÁC PHƯƠNG PHÁP QUẢN LÝ DEADLOCKS ... Galvin and Gagne ©2005 CẤU TRÚC HỆ THỐNG UNIX Operating System ... maurice watts